Overview
Student Nurse Residency Program
Funder: Regional Medical Center (RMC Health System)
Geographic Scope: Anniston, Alabama
Purpose: Provides nursing students with hands-on training and mentorship during their nursing program, particularly for students in their 3rd semester and beyond.
Eligibility Requirements
- Currently enrolled in an accredited nursing program
- In at least 3rd semester of nursing program
- Minimum GPA typically required (specific threshold should be confirmed)
- Must be available to work while completing nursing studies
Program Details
- Placement at Regional Medical Center or Stringfellow Memorial Hospital
- Supervised clinical experience in nursing roles
- Mentorship from experienced nursing staff
- Integration of theoretical knowledge with practical patient care

How to Apply
Application Process
1. Complete online application form with personal and educational information
2. Provide education details:
- Name of college/nursing program
- Current GPA
- Expected graduation date
- Anticipated start date (3rd semester)
3. Employment history section:
- List previous work experience
- Provide supervisor contact information
4. Background information:
- Disclose any prior convictions
- List any RMC relatives or prior employment/volunteer experience
5. Submit essay: Explain why you should be selected for the program (required)
6. Upload required documents:
- Official transcript (max 25 MB)
- Three letters of recommendation from professional and academic references (max 25 MB per file, up to 3 files)
7. Sign consent form for information release
8. Complete health screening duties requirement (tuberculosis screening, background check, etc.)
Submission: Online form submission
Note: Specific application deadline not provided. Contact RMC for current deadlines and program start dates.
